Construction of the Yläkartanonkuja technical shaft has begun

Construction of the Yläkartanonkuja technical shaft has begun as part of Länsimetro’s Soukka metro station construction contract. When the metro is completed, the technical shaft will serve as the smoke extraction, pressure equalisation and ventilation system.

Construction of the shaft has begun with the excavation of the foundation, and rock drilling and bolting. The work will continue with concrete construction work, after which steel structures will be built inside the shaft. The final work will involve roof work and exterior cladding.
